The size of Wellington Point is approximately 9.7 square kilometres. There are 48 parks, covering nearly 34.3% of the total area. The population of Wellington Point in 2016 was 12350 people. By 2021 the population was 12661 showing a population growth of 2.5%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Wellington Point is 50-59 years. Households in Wellington Point are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Wellington Point work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 78.90% of the homes in Wellington Point were owner-occupied compared with 76.30% in 2016.
